Born Marina Ann Hantzis, Sasha Grey entered the adult industry in 2006 at age 18. Within two years, she became one of the most acclaimed performers of her era—winning multiple AVN Awards and becoming the youngest recipient of the organization’s "Female Performer of the Year" (2008). Grey entered the adult film industry in 2006 at the age of 18. She quickly distinguished herself not through the typical "girl-next-door" archetype, but through an aggressive, raw performance style that challenged the passive portrayal of women in the genre. She was an avowed feminist who argued that her work was an exercise in agency—an exploration of the body and taboo.
